There is little information available, the GitHub discussions post says:

   "We are cutting the release cycle short and will release curl 8.4.0 on
    October 11, including fixes for a severity HIGH CVE and one severity
    LOW. The one rated HIGH is probably the worst curl security flaw in
    a long time.

    The new version and details about the two CVEs will be published
    around 06:00 UTC on the release day.

    * CVE-2023-38545: severity HIGH (affects both libcurl and the curl tool)
    * CVE-2023-38546: severity LOW (affects libcurl only, not the tool)

    Now you know. Plan accordingly."
